Greg Walton

@meta_lab

Investigating politically motivated malware attacks since 2008

This is not a whale: South China Morning Post (SCMP) Ferrari #failwhale

Views 128

959 days ago

This is not a whale: South China Morning Post (SCMP) Ferrari #failwhale

0 Comments

Realtime comments disabled